Zoning Administrator Mabusth stated that the North Shore Drive Marina is requesting a building permit for the purpose of constructing a 72' x 40 ' repair shop. Mabusth noted the North Shore Drive Marina is a non- conforming commercial use in a residential zone . Larry Hork stated that right now he can' t service his customers and needs this building . Hork stated that his main concern is getting the building permit for the repair shop. Hork noted that he is very close to resolution of the problem with the LMCD. Horkstated thathe intends to remodel the main building . City Attorney Malkerson stated that back in 1956 , the City Council down zoned the property. Malkerson stated that there was litigation and they lost . Malkerson noted in 1973-74 when the City did their Comprehensive Plan, there was a recommendation from the Planning Commission that this property be rezoned from B-2 commercial to LR-1C-1 residential . Malkerson stated after a few public hearing s the Council rezoned that property from commercial to residential . Malkerson stated Mr . Hork commenced a lawsuit challenging the validity of that and the City responded . Malkerson stated since that there haven' t been any further pleadings by the plantiff . Malkerson stated that the City did not push for completion of the litigation and the City waited for Mr . Horkto proceed buttheydidn ' t. Malkersonstated at this point the property has been rezoned from commercial to residential . Malkerson stated as residential property under the code there should not be expansion of the marina . Councilmember Grabek asked the reasoning of the Council for the rezoning of the property from commercial to residential . City Attorney Malkerson stated that he recalls that some of the reasoning had to do with compatibility with existing zoning , traffic , and adverse effects on surrounding properties. Malkerson stated that the laws between 1966-198Q are so different . Malkerson stated that since this property was rezoned under the Comprehensive Plan , Mr . Hork is allowed to continue his operation that existed at the time of rezoning as long as he doesn ' t expand . Councilmember Hammerel asked if there had been any complaints from the neighbors . PAGE 4 �798 NORTH SHORE DRIVE MARINA Larry Hork stated that at the time of the rezoning he had made application to the Planning Commission for a building permit to install a full marina building on the property, which included shop facilities and sales facilities . Hork stated the City rezoned the property and as a result of the court action that was put aside. Hork stated he reinstigated that application in 1970 , to see how the Planning Commission would feel at that time. Hork noted again at the time of the rezoning , they had submitted an application for building permits on the property. Hork noted that the lawsuit was only for their property and not the whole strip of iand along there that was rezoned . Hork stated that the judge ruled that the property had every right to remain commercial and the judge ordered a dismissal and at that time he agreed to waive hisrightsanddismissthataction. Horkstated that the judge cautioned the Mayor and Councilmembers that Mr . Hork could ask to reopen that case if the City didn' t act in good faith. Hork stated that the City acting in good faith meant that they would rezone and sustain the commercial zoning of that marina .
